1、当使用npm安装一些全局的软件包时,不知道安装到了什么位置,可以使用命令 npm root -g 进行查询 npm root -g 通常默认会保存在以下位置: C:\Users\username\AppData\Roaming\npm\node_modules 2、地址: http://www.wjhsh.net/xiami2046-p-12912019.html 问题二 n
原因: 这是由于pycharm的全局搜索的快捷方式和win10的简繁体输出切换的快捷方式冲突了 解决:首先回到中文输出法,再次按下 ctrl+shift+f即可,即切换到简体的输入模式
1 自定义频率类 # 自定义的逻辑 #(1)取出访问者ip {192.168.1.12:[访问时间3,访问时间2,访问时间1],192.168.1.12:[],192.168.1.14:[]} #(2)判断当前ip不在访问字典里,添加进去,并且直接返回True,表示第一次访问,在字典里,继续往下走 #(3)循环判断当前ip的列表,有值,并且当前时间减去列表的最
全局异常处理(重要) 使用drf的异常处理可以捕获drf的报错信息,但是django或者原生python的报错信息也需要我们处理,这些捕获到的信息都需要我们封装好发送到前端,这是我们全局处理异常的目的。 # drf配置文件中,已经配置了,但是它不符合咱们的要求 # drf的配置文件:'EXCEPTION_HANDLER':
前言 : 组件系统是Vue.js其中一个重要的概念,它提供了一种抽象,让我们可以使用独立可复用的小组件来构建大型应用,任意类型的应用界面都可以抽象为一个组件树。 现在基于vue的UI组件库有很多,比如iview,element-ui等。但有时候这些组件库满足不了我们的开发需求,这时候我们就需要自己写
<head> <script> this.globalThis || (this.globalThis = this) </script> ... </head>思路是:既然全局上没有定义 globalThis 那我们就判断一下,如果没有的情况下,定义全局的一个 globalThis 指向全局 this 对象(也就是 window 对象)。
//过滤日期 import Vue from 'vue' import moment from "moment" Vue.filter('dateFilter', (data) => { // 日期处理函数 - moment if (data !== '' && data !== null && data !== undefined) { return moment(d
1.需要使用全局变量和方法: 将变量标记为public、static和final,将方法标记为public和static使其行为更像全局 2.如何生成全局函数和全局数据 静态的东西是类似于全局,他们代表的是一种非常特殊的情况。 3.什么是Java程序,需要表达的是什么 Java程序是Java应用程序中的一堆类(或至少一
/** * 全局异常处理 * @author Administrator * */ @ControllerAdvice public class GloableExceptionController extends BaseController{ /** * 拦截Exception类型异常 * 所有的异常都可以用该类来接受 * @param request * @param ex *
自定义工具类utils 创建js文件 import axios from "axios"; const request = axios.create({ baseURL: 'http://localhost:3000', }) export default request main.js全局引入 // 导入自定义包 import request from '@/utils/request.js'; //其中$xx为新命的名 V
语法 全局using你再也不用每个类里都引用命名空间了 项目的csproj文件中加入 <ItemGroup> <PackageReference Include="LeetCode.CommunityToolKit" Version="4.0.3" /> <Using Include="LeetCode.CommunityToolKit.Models;" /> <Using
https://blog.csdn.net/hxy199421/article/details/83030603 来回切换中英文输入法的时候,idea会弹出来一个搜索框,像下图那样,很不方便,现在要把那个弹出框禁用掉。 1、按ctrl+shift+a,弹出如下图的搜索框。 2、输入registry,然后按回车。 3、找到“ide.suppress.double
(1)添加用户到docker用户组 sudo groupadd docker sudo gpasswd -a kang docker (注销系统当前用户,再次登录) #检查是否添加到组 cat /etc/group 注意:如果提示get ......dial unix /var/run/docker.sock权限不够 则修改/var/run/docker.sock权限 sudo chmod a+rw /var/
Java全局处理异常 引言 对于controller中的代码,为了保证其稳定性,我们总会对每一个controller中的代码进行try-catch,但是由于接口太多,try-catch会显得太冗杂,spring为我们提供了全局处理异常的方式 @ExceptionHandler @RestControllerAdvice 项目构建 项目结构 相关依赖
一、建立立方体类 class cube { public://公共 //设置长 void setL(float l) { L = l; } //获取长 float getL() { return L; } //设置宽 void setW(float w) { W= w; } //获取宽 float getW() { return W; } //设置高 void setH(float h) { H = h;
1.名称空间 名称空间(namespaces):存放名字的地方,是对栈区的划分。有了名称空间之后,就可以在栈区中存放相同的名字,不会冲突。 详细的名称空间:分为三种: 1.1 内置名称空间 # 存放的名字:存放的python解释器内置的名字 >>> print <built-in function print> >>> input <built-in funct
下面将会实现这样的效果: 创建Notice组件模板: 组件模板 <template> <transition enter-active-class="animate__animated animate__slideInRight" leave-active-class="animate__animated animate__slideOutRight" @after-leave="afterLeave&qu
这两天除了忙着续航,还有一个让我头疼的就是全局手写。 只能在文件管理里面调出来,在想啥?我用笔给文件夹重命名??? 笔记里也是坏掉的状态,一调出来就切换到小艺输入法。我要小艺有何用?卡就不说了,一堆快捷操作全都不支持。 最后,在我快要走投无路的时候,一款平时在用的清单软件让我眼前一亮
const express = require('express') const app = express() // 定义第一个全局中间件 app.use((req, res, next) => { console.log('调用了第1个全局中间件') next() }) // 定义第二个全局中间件 app.use((req, res, next) => { console.log('调用了第2个全局中间件')
ABAP创建全局类 1 *&---------------------------------------------------------------------* 2 *& Report Z3426_CLASS004 3 *&---------------------------------------------------------------------* 4 *& 5 *&---------------------------
of5版本以后对欧拉-拉格朗日方法中求解的颗粒坐标输出,根据网格剖分和体心坐标进行了变化,输出结果不是去全局坐标。因此若第position文档进行处理难度很大,我们需要直接的去全局颗粒坐标,便于直接处理。解决思路: 在/src/basic/lagrangian/particle/particleIO.C源程序中对输出坐标代
转载请注明出处: 1.查看所有键 keys * 该命令会存在线程阻塞问题,keys 命令也可以通过正则匹配获取存在的缓存数据 2.查看键总数 dbsize dbsize命令会返回当前数据库中键的总数。 dbsize命令在计算键总数时不会遍历所有键,而是直接获取Redis内置的键总数
promise作为JavaScript中处理异步任务的api,真的非常好用,这里简单分享下个人学习的一些demo,以便快速理解。 promise具体概念就不多说了,可参考MDN文档 demo: // 当写了then 没写catch 则会捕获,then 也不写,则不会捕获,写了catch也不会捕获 window.addEventList